Whew! I knew this was going to be a tricky replanting and it was but went more smoothly than I'd expected. This mini bog started out in 2023 as a random throwing things together with different Sundew seed stalks, moss and some Butterworts in a Tupperware-type container using coconut coir as the growing medium and I actually didn't expect it to survive. It seemed to (mostly) do okay and it was time to move it to a larger container. #CarnivorousPlants #Mosstodon #gardening #Plants @plants

@plants using coconut coir was interesting and doable, but you really have to keep on top of flushing the whole thing out with pure (0 total dissolved solids) water a lot more often than with peat-based mediums. Minerals continued to leach out (even when pre-soaked and rinsed) for several months until it stabilized. Just my annual reminder that if you think you *might* need your assistive gear for FOSDEM, you probably *do* need your assistive gear at FOSDEM. Brussels and ULB isn't an easy one to navigate and while I don't use my walking cane daily anymore, I keep it with me for this (and C3). You'll want to try to keep the balance of packing light and still having everything on hand you'll need. #fosdem #fossdem26 #fosdem2026

Brussels has some shops for gear like canes, crutches and wheelchairs in the city center, but the hours are short, the selection is limited and prices are high.

If it is your first time in Brussels with a walking cane or crutches- please keep an eye on the ground for loose paving stones/bricks, mystery holes and general randomness.
